The data in Concrsts2 represent the compressive strength in thousands of pounds per square inch of 40 samples of concrete taken 2, 7, and 28 days after pouring.
a. At the 0.05 level of significance. is there evidence of a difference in the mean compressive strength after 2, 7, and 28 days?
b. If appropriate, use the Tukey procedure to determine the days that differ in mean compressive strength.
c. Determine the relative efficiency of the randomized block de-sign as compared with the completely randomized (one-way ANOVA) design.
d. Construct boxplots of the compressive strength for the different time periods.
e. Based on the results of (a), (b), and (d), is there a pattern in the compressive strength over the three time periods?
